Overview
Vernonia mokaensis Mildbr. & Mattf. is a species of flowering plant from the family Asteraceae and is native to Cameroon in Central Africa. This plant is a small tree with many medicinal properties and is often used by traditional healers in its native range.
Common Names
The plant is commonly known as Kui or Mowefu in Cameroon.
Appearance
Vernonia mokaensis Mildbr. & Mattf. is a small tree that grows to a height of 7-10 meters. The leaves are simple, alternate, and elliptical in shape, with a smooth surface and a leathery texture. The flowers of the plant are small and grouped together in dense heads. The heads are surrounded by involucral bracts with a purple color on the outside and a white color on the inside. The fruits of the plant are achenes, which are small dry fruits that do not open at maturity.
